    November 27, 2022 - Penultimate bottle - quite a raisiny nose with prunes and spices. Rich spicey palate. I think at its best or maybe a slight decline

    November 13, 2022 - Saturday night with Auntie Ro and Braised Shortrib (Leafy West London): Been a bit of a Ridgey weekend so thought we'd try this with dinner. Enjoyed with some braised beef from the back of the freezer. Colour - garnet with still a hint of purple. On the nose - pretty muted to begin with, needed to sniff hard but some red fruits, a hint of spice. On the palate - some red fruits, redcurrant, very ripe strawberries but no jamminess. A lovely call with some weirdly refreshing acidity, gentle tannins and some spiciness from the oak. My most enjoyable bottle of this wine? Maybe so. No rush at all to drink up - this is going to keep going - but equally, it's giving a great deal of pleasure now.

    April 8, 2022 - Bowl of dark room temperature berries on the nose, w/ tobacco leaves. Concentrated juicy elderberry, boysenberry, dried leaves that ebb and flow nicely. a great geyserville, tannins becoming resolved, still plenty of grip and acidity to match the concentrated dark fruit.Seems to have dropped some oak and sweetness, drinking tremendously. Fruit heavy, bracing acidity and well balanced. Terrific.

    December 17, 2021 - Tasted over 2 hrs
    -saturated purple, minimal clearing
    -lovely ripe almost jammy berry with a prominent wet stone streak
    -barely med acidity, med/med+ weight somewhat unidimensional ripe sweet dark berry with nice minerality and some early mature elements and noticeable but not overwhelming heat mingling with the med tannins
    -excellent minerality, would drink sooner than later to enjoy the residual fruit while it can still absorb the heat
